Linux vs Windows Servers: Key Differences
When it comes to server operating systems, two of the most prevalent choices are Linux and Windows. Each platform offers unique advantages and caters to different needs. Understanding the key differences between Linux and Windows servers can help businesses make informed decisions based on their requirements.
1. Cost
One of the most significant differences between Linux and Windows servers is cost. Linux is an open-source operating system, meaning it is free to use, modify, and distribute. This makes it an attractive option for budget-conscious organizations. In contrast, Windows servers typically require licensing fees, which can quickly add up, especially for businesses needing multiple server instances.
2. Stability and Performance
Linux servers are renowned for their stability and uptime. With lower resource consumption, Linux can handle multiple tasks efficiently, making it a preferred choice for mission-critical applications. Windows servers, while improving in performance over the years, may require more frequent reboots and updates, which can affect uptime.
3. Security
Security is a critical consideration for any server environment. Linux is generally considered more secure due to its open-source nature, allowing the community to identify and fix vulnerabilities quickly. Additionally, Linux server distributions often come with robust security features and regular updates. Windows servers, while improving their security protocols, remain a frequent target for malware and cyber attacks due to their widespread use.
4. Ease of Use
Windows servers tend to be more user-friendly, especially for those familiar with Windows desktop environments. The graphical user interface (GUI) allows users to navigate and manage servers without extensive command-line knowledge. On the other hand, Linux servers are often managed through command-line interfaces (CLI), which can be intimidating for new users. However, those willing to learn will find that the CLI offers powerful control and flexibility.
5. Software Compatibility
Software compatibility is another crucial factor to consider. Windows servers are compatible with a wide range of commercial software, especially enterprise applications developed specifically for Windows. Linux supports a broad array of open-source software and is especially popular for web hosting, databases, and development environments. Organizations that rely on specific software should evaluate compatibility before choosing an OS.
6. Community and Support
Linux benefits from a strong community of developers and users who contribute to forums, documentation, and troubleshooting. While this support can be invaluable, it may lack the structured assistance found in commercial support packages. Conversely, Windows servers come with professional support from Microsoft, which can be crucial for organizations needing guaranteed help with issues.
7. Customization
Linux offers unparalleled customization options, allowing users to tailor their server environments to meet specific needs. From choosing the kernel to selecting software packages, Linux provides flexibility for diverse applications. Windows has limited customization options, centered primarily on pre-defined configurations and settings.
Conclusion
Choosing between Linux and Windows servers ultimately depends on your organization's specific requirements, budget, and technical expertise. Linux stands out for its cost-effectiveness, stability, and security, while Windows excels in user-friendliness and commercial software compatibility. Assessing these key differences can guide you towards the right server solution for your needs.
